@charset 'utf-8';
/* CSS Document */
#useContents{
	width:945px;
    margin-left:auto;
    margin-right:auto;
	
    }

#useContents h2.h2title{
	margin:5% 0;
	color:#F69 !important;
	font-size:1.8rem;
	line-height:120%;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
}


#useContents p{
	margin:5% 0;
	font-size:1.3rem;
	line-height:150%;
	text-align:center;
	color:#555 !important;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
}

#useContents p.cap{
	margin:2% 0;
	font-size:1.0rem;
	line-height:150%;
	text-align:left;
	color:#555 !important;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
}

#useContents h3 {
	font-size:1.8rem;
	padding: 1% 0;
	color:#F69;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
	width:50%;
	text-align:center;
	margin-left:auto;
    margin-right:auto;
	margin-bottom:4%;
	font-weight:normal;
}


/*メニュー枠*/
.useBoxContainer01{
	width:100%;
	background-color:#F3F3F3;
	padding:4%;
}

/*２つ並び左*/
.menubox01{
	display: inline-block;
	width:46%;
	margin:0 2%;
}

.menubox01 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}

/*２つ並び右*/
.menubox02 {
	display: inline-block;
	 width:46%;
}

.menubox02 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}

/*関連リンク枠*/
.useBoxContainer02{
	width:100%;
	background-color: #FFF0F9;
	padding:4% 4% 6% 4%;
}

#useContents p.link{
	margin:5% 0 0 0;
	font-size:0.9rem;
	line-height:150%;
	text-align:left;
	color:#555 !important;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
}

#useContents p.useLinkIcon{
	margin:5% 0 0 0;
	width:90%;
	padding:2px;
	border:1px solid #F69;
	border-radius: 5px;        /* CSS3草案 */  
    -webkit-border-radius: 5px;    /* Safari,Google Chrome用 */  
    -moz-border-radius: 5px;   /* Firefox用 */  
	font-size:0.9rem;
	line-height:150%;
	text-align:left;
	color:#F69 !important;
	font-family: "游ゴシック体", "Yu Gothic", YuGothic, 'Hiragino Kaku Gothic Pro', 'ヒラギノ角ゴ Pro W3', Meiryo, メイリオ, sans-serif !important;
}

#useContents p.useLinkIcon img{
	float:left;
	margin-left:4px;
	margin-right:4px;
}

/*４つ並び１番目*/
.useBox01{
	display: inline-block;
	width:23.5%;
	margin:0 1.5% 0 0;
	padding:2%;
		background:#FFF;
		border-bottom:3px solid #999;
}

.useBox01 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}

/*４つ並び２番目*/
.useBox02 {
	display: inline-block;
	 width:23.5%;
	 margin:0 1.5% 0 0;
	 padding:2%;
	 	background:#FFF;
		border-bottom:3px solid #999;
}

.useBox02 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}

/*４つ並び３番目*/
.useBox03{
	display: inline-block;
	width:23.5%;
	margin:0 1.5% 0 0;
	padding:2%;
		background:#FFF;
		border-bottom:3px solid #999;
}

.useBox03 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}

/*４つ並び４番目*/
.useBox04{
	display: inline-block;
	width:23.5%;
	padding:2%;
	background:#FFF;
	border-bottom:3px solid #999;
}

.useBox04 a:hover img{
	opacity: 0.7;
  filter: alpha(opacity=70);
  -ms-filter: "alpha(opacity=70)";
}
